      Job Description:

      Manufacturing Technicians perform functions associated with all wafer production including operations, equipment's, process, and training. Collects and evaluates operating data to conduct online equipment adjustment and ensure process optimization. Responsible for running lots in a qualitative way. Also, responsible for preventive maintenance, troubleshooting, spares, and sustaining. In addition, the Manufacturing Technician is responsible for improvement processes, troubleshooting nonstandard events in the production line, and reviewing technological health and stability. The Manufacturing Technician may be responsible for the buddy, trainer, and certifier levels and is in charge of updating training manuals. May participate in safety forums and Emergency Response Team as required. Work is somewhat complex and is performed within the spectrum ranging from narrowly defined parameters and limited judgment up to highly complex and nonstandard assignments in nature and broadly defined parameters. High degree of judgment and initiative is required in resolving complex nonstandard problems and developing recommendations. Normally receives general instructions on routine work, and detailed instructions on new work.

      Minimum Qualifications:

      The candidate must possess at least one of the below requirements:

      • High School Diploma with 1+ year of technical certification or technical trade school experience.
      • High School Diploma with 1+ year of semiconductor equipment maintenance experience.
      • High School Diploma with 2+ years of experience in manufacturing field or technical military experience.
      • An Associate's degree in a STEM discipline.

      In addition, the candidate must be willing to:

      • Work a day shift compressed workweek schedule. The schedule will consist of three twelve-hour days in a row followed by a fourth day every other week. This is a days, back end of the week shift going from AM to PM, starting Thursday through Saturday, with a week on week off Wednesday shift.
      • Work in a cleanroom environment wearing coveralls, hoods, booties, safety glasses, and gloves.
      • Lift up to 25 lbs. 5 times/shift, spend the majority of the time on the floor working toolsets, walking 2-4 miles a day, and/or standing/sitting for 9 hours.

      Preferred Qualifications:

      • Experience in mechanical maintenance, manufacturing environment, semiconductor environment, or related field.
      • An Associate's degree in a STEM discipline with 1+ years of experience in a technical/manufacturing field.
      • A Bachelor's degree in a STEM discipline
